McIndoe forceps are a widely recognized type of dissecting forceps known for their longer, more slender profile and often finely serrated tips, suitable for grasping and separating tissues. When adapted for monopolar electrosurgery, the Mcindone Monopolar Forceps LX-1657 transforms these capabilities into a powerful tool for achieving hemostasis or facilitating dissection electrosurgically across various surgical specialties, including general surgery, plastic surgery, and gynecology.
Specialized McIndoe Forceps Design
The Mcindone Monopolar Forceps LX-1657 features the distinctive design of McIndoe forceps. These forceps typically have a more elongated and slender shaft compared to other types, which can provide improved access to deeper surgical planes or allow for manipulation over a broader area. The tips often feature fine serrations designed to securely grasp tissue with minimal trauma.
This specialized design makes the instrument well-suited for dissecting through various tissue layers or grasping vessels for coagulation during procedures where a finer touch or slightly greater reach than standard forceps is needed.

Monopolar Configuration and Safety
Operating within a monopolar electrosurgical circuit, the LX-1657 requires the use of a patient return electrode (grounding pad) to complete the circuit. Electrosurgical current flows from the ESU, through the active instrument (the LX-1657 tips), through the patient’s tissue, to the return electrode, and back to the ESU.
High-quality insulation along the instrument’s shaft and handle is paramount for safe monopolar electrosurgery. The LX-1657 is engineered with effective insulation to ensure that electrosurgical energy is safely confined to the working tips, protecting the patient and the surgical team from unintended burns or current leakage.
